Overview

Collagen-encoding messenger RNAs (mRNAs) are the essential genetic templates that direct the synthesis of collagen proteins, which constitute the primary structural framework of the extracellular matrix in vertebrates (NCBI Gene, 2024). These mRNAs, transcribed from genes such as COL1A1 and COL3A1, are highly regulated during tissue development and repair but become pathologically overexpressed in various fibrotic conditions (PubMed, 2023). In diseases like liver cirrhosis and pulmonary fibrosis, the persistent elevation of collagen mRNA leads to the accumulation of scar tissue, eventually resulting in organ failure. Conversely, mutations within these mRNA sequences can lead to the production of defective proteins, causing hereditary disorders like Osteogenesis imperfecta (UniProt, 2024). Modern pharmacological approaches aim to modulate these levels using RNA-based therapies, such as siRNAs and antisense oligonucleotides, to selectively silence collagen production in diseased tissues (ClinicalTrials.gov, 2023). While most clinical-stage candidates currently target collagen-related chaperones like HSP47, direct targeting of collagen mRNA remains a high-priority strategy for treating chronic fibroproliferative diseases.

Mechanism of action

Therapeutic agents targeting collagen-encoding mRNAs typically employ RNA interference (RNAi) or antisense oligonucleotides (ASOs) to bind specifically to the mRNA sequence. This binding either triggers the degradation of the mRNA transcript via the RISC complex or physically obstructs the ribosome, thereby preventing the translation of the mRNA into collagen proteins and reducing excessive extracellular matrix deposition.
